redis负载均衡
- tomcat+Nginx负载均衡对session处理2
-
上一节,我们把session的原理分析了一下,对缓存机制做了一个解释,引入我们的缓存机制memcached,同时也提到了一套开源的memcached管理方案MemcachedSessionManager,并着手开始安装了memcached,如果需要看回之前的文章,请关注我的头条号:一点热,然后阅...
- 使用新的负载均衡策略改进微服务
-
通过使用Ribbon等工具在客户端和使用Nginx在服务器端确保适当的负载分配,可以增强系统可扩展性和弹性。译自ImproveMicroservicesWithTheseNewLoadBalancingStrategies,作者DhruvKumarSeth。从单体架构到...
- tomcat+redis+nginx的session共享
-
上两节中,我们使用nginx+tomcat+memcached+MSM实现session共享,如何有需要对nginx负载均衡方面的知识需要了解的话,可以关注我的头条号:一点热。然后阅读之前的文章。同时,我已经把上一节配置的资料放到github了,如果需要配置的资源可以在上面下载,地址https://...
- springboot + redis实现分布式session
-
在分布式系统中,为了实现会话(Session)共享,常用的方法之一是使用Redis来存储会话数据。SpringBoot可以很容易地与Redis集成,通过SpringSession项目来实现分布式Session管理。原理Session共享问题:在传统的单体应用中,用户的Session信息存储在服务...
- nginx负载均衡-普通hash和一致性hash负载均衡实现
-
哈希负载均衡原理??ngx_http_upstream_hash_module支持普通的hash及一致性hash两种负载均衡算法,默认的是普通的hash来进行负载均衡。??nginx普通的hash算法支持配置http变量值作为hash值计算的key,通过hash计算得出的hash值和总权重的余...
- 负载均衡之LVS与Nginx对比
-
今天总结一下负载均衡中LVS与Nginx的区别,好几篇博文一开始就说LVS是单向的,Nginx是双向的,我个人认为这是不准确的,LVS三种模式中,虽然DR模式以及TUN模式只有请求的报文经过Director,但是NAT模式,RealServer回复的报文也会经过DirectorServer地址重...
- spring+redis+nginx实现session共享
-
上一节,我们讲到使用tomcat+nginx+redis实现session的共享,如果对上一节不是很了解,欢迎订阅我的头条号:一点热,然后阅读之前的文章。上一章节的项目已经放到github里面。https://github.com/yeehot/tomcat_redis_nginx_sessiont...
- 基于Redis内核的热key统计实现方案|得物技术
-
一、Redis热key介绍Redis热key问题是指单位时间内,某个特定key的访问量特别高,占用大量的CPU资源,影响其他请求并导致整体性能降低。而且,如果访问热key的命令是时间复杂度较高的命令,会使得CPU消耗变得更加严重;或者,如果访问的热key同时也是一个大key,也可能使得访问流量达到节...
- 每个 Java 程序员都必须知道的四种负载均衡算法
-
要成为一名软件架构师,你必须掌握负载均衡算法。一般来说,我们在设计系统的时候,为了系统的高扩展性,会尽可能的把系统创建为无状态的,这样我们就可以将它以集群的方式部署,这样我们就可以很容易地根据情况动态地增加或减少服务器的数量。到系统的访问。但是,要使系统具有更好的可扩展性,除了无状态设计之外,关键考...
- 「分布式」 分布式系统的负载均衡
-
一、什么是负载均衡?什么是负载均衡?记得第一次接触Nginx是在实验室,那时候在服务器部署网站需要用Nginx。Nginx是一个服务组件,用来反向代理、负载平衡和HTTP缓存等。那么这里的负载均衡是什么?负载均衡(LB,LoadBalance),是一种技术解决方案。用来在多个资...